Sr. ML engineer with GenAI
Contract 6+ Month
What You'll Do
- Architect and implement advanced deep learning models for multimodal recommendation systems, processing diverse data types including text, images, user behavior, item features, offer data, and contextual signals.
- Lead the development and optimization of generative AI applications for personalized product discovery, search enhancement, and customer engagement.
- Design and maintain highly scalable ML infrastructure using GCP services (Vertex AI, BigTable, BigQuery, Cloud Composer) capable of handling millions of daily predictions.
- Build and optimize end-to-end ML pipelines for model training, deployment, and monitoring at scale.
- Drive architecture decisions for the personalization platform.
- Collaborate with product managers, data scientists, and engineers to translate business requirements into robust technical solutions.
- Lead experimentation strategies with measurable KPIs including adoption, conversion & retention.
Required Qualifications
- Master's or PhD in Computer Science, Machine Learning, or related field.
- 7+ years of experience in machine learning engineering, with focus on recommendation systems or personalization.
- Strong expertise in deep learning frameworks (PyTorch or TensorFlow) and building production-grade ML systems.
- Proven experience with GCP services and ML infrastructure at scale.
- Proficient in Python, SQL, and cloud-native development.
- Experience with containerization (Docker) and orchestration (Kubernetes).
- Track record of deploying ML models to production at scale.
Preferred Qualifications
- Experience with multimodal deep learning architectures and generative AI models.
- Knowledge of modern recommendation system architectures (transformers, neural collaborative filtering).
- Expertise in building real-time inference systems.
- Experience with distributed computing frameworks (Spark) and big data processing.
Familiarity with Apache Airflow (Cloud Composer) and CI/CD pipelines.
Seniority level
Seniority level
Mid-Senior level
Employment type
Job function
Job function
Engineering and Information TechnologyIndustries
Staffing and Recruiting
Referrals increase your chances of interviewing at Hays by 2x
Sign in to set job alerts for “Data Scientist” roles.
Toronto, Ontario, Canada CA$70.00-CA$75.00 20 hours ago
Toronto, Ontario, Canada CA$80,000.00-CA$85,000.00 3 weeks ago
Toronto, Ontario, Canada $35.00-$41.00 23 hours ago
Toronto, Ontario, Canada CA$62.00-CA$62.00 3 weeks ago
Toronto, Ontario, Canada CA$175,000.00-CA$175,000.00 2 weeks ago
Toronto, Ontario, Canada $85,000.00-$135,000.00 2 weeks ago
We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.